It’s a pretty stupid policy - analysis suggests it could see $150-250 billion in taxes not being collected, so it’s a pretty enormous tax cut.

A better option would be policy to reduce the need for tipping (ie decent pay for tipped workers).
I'm all for higher wages but the tipping culture is ingrained in the US and any increase in the minimum wage results in squealing from business owners and suggestions of a breakout in inflation, so that's just not going to happen.

In the context of the taxes on individual taxpayers being $1.89 trillion in the current year (and overall US government revenue being $3.75 trillion), $150-$250 billion over ten years is not much more than a rounding error.
